Red Nose Day at Ysgol y Gogarth: A Student Council Success

Red Nose Day brought a wave of excitement to Ysgol y Gogarth, and this year, it was the student council leading the charge. With creativity and enthusiasm, they organised a day filled with fun and fundraising for a good cause.


Students were invited to ditch their usual uniforms and embrace the wacky side of fashion, sporting colourful outfits and wild hairstyles.


One of the main attractions of the day was the student council-run café, where teas, coffees, and homemade cakes were served. Generously donated by our staff and parents, these treats added to the atmosphere and helped raise funds for charity.


Among the highlights was Kerrie Hopwood's stunning cake, earning her well-deserved praise for the best-decorated cake. Additionally, Dosbarth Tal-Y-Fan and Dosbarth Peris shared victory in the staff/student quiz, showcasing their knowledge and teamwork.


As the day came to a close, there was a sense of pride and accomplishment. The student council had not only organised a day of fun but had also made a meaningful contribution to a worthy cause. Well done to the student council and everyone involved for their hard work and dedication!
